ATOF(3)			   Linux Programmer's Manual		       ATOF(3)

NAME
       atof - convert a	string to a double.

SYNOPSIS
       #include	<stdlib.h>

       double atof(const char *nptr);

DESCRIPTION
       The  atof() function converts the initial portion of the	string pointed
       to by nptr to double.  The behaviour is the same	as

	      strtod(nptr, (char **)NULL);

       except that atof() does not detect errors.

RETURN VALUE
       The converted value.

CONFORMING TO
       SVID 3, POSIX, BSD 4.3, ISO 9899
